Originally designed back in 2001 with Alana Medina, TechStencil is a unicase face characterized by its sleek extended forms and rounded terminals. Recent updates in 2009 include improved kerning and character modifications. Upper and lowercase characters can be mixed and matched for various effects. Test Run & Purchase

Inspired by mosaic lettering by Heins & LaFarge, architects of the IRT (Interborough Rapid Transit) in New York City. Bedford hints at the station names on platform walls which date back to 1904 but modernize it through a rigid grid system and rounded corners. Influenced by the classic German industrial typeface DIN, Bockhold strays from the grid system and into humanist nuances adding warmth and accessibility. The family consists of two weights with matching italics, making a total of four fonts. Stay tuned for the Ultralight and Medium weights. Test Run & Purchase

A futuristic grid-based interpretation of the classic Prisma by Rudolf Koch (1927-29). Prizma2012 breaks away from typical rounded characteristics of most Multiline designs and embraces 45 degree angles, a rigid grid system and open ended terminals. Intended for use at large sizes, the family comes with four weights for optimal impact. Test Run & Purchase
